The Massey Ferguson 253 was a popular agricultural tractor produced in the late 1980s and early 1990s. Known for its reliability and versatility, the MF 253 was typically powered by a Perkins diesel engine, delivering around 47 horsepower. Its robust design and practical PTO horsepower made it a favorite for smaller farms and various tasks.
The Massey Ferguson 253 was part of the highly successful 200 series, known for their dependability and ease of use. Production spanned from the late 1980s to the early 1990s, making it a readily available choice for farmers seeking a reliable utility tractor. The heart of the MF 253 is typically a Perkins AD3.152 three-cylinder diesel engine, providing approximately 47 horsepower with a displacement of 152 cubic inches. This diesel engine contributes to the tractor's fuel efficiency and longevity. The transmission is a mechanical gear type, usually offering 8 forward and 2 reverse speeds, providing a good range for various field operations. The PTO delivers around 40 horsepower at the standard 540 RPM, making it suitable for powering implements like rotary cutters, balers, and tillers. The hydraulic system has a capacity of around 7-8 GPM, powering the 3-point hitch, which is typically a Category I or II, providing a lift capacity of approximately 2500-3000 lbs. The MF 253 found applications in row crop operations, hay production, livestock management, and light tillage tasks. Compared to other models in the Massey Ferguson lineup, the 253 offered a balance of power, economy, and ease of operation, making it a sought-after choice for farmers needing a versatile utility tractor.
Specifications
| Engine | Perkins AD3.152 47 HP Diesel |
|---|---|
| PTO HP | 40 HP @ 540 RPM |
| Transmission | Gear 8F/2R |
| Hydraulics | 7-8 GPM, 1-2 remotes |
| 3-Point Hitch | Category I/II, 2500-3000 lbs |
| Fuel Capacity | 16 gallons |
| Weight | 4,500 lbs |
| Years Produced | Late 1980s - Early 1990s |
Maintenance Tips
- Engine Oil & Filter: Change the engine oil and filter every 250 hours of operation. Use a high-quality diesel engine oil meeting API CF-4 or better specifications.
- Hydraulic System: Inspect hydraulic fluid levels regularly and change the hydraulic filter every 500 hours. Use only recommended hydraulic fluid to prevent damage to seals and components.
- Fuel System: Keep the fuel system clean by using a fuel filter and draining the fuel sediment bowl regularly. Consider adding a fuel additive to prevent algae growth, especially during seasonal storage.
- Seasonal Storage: Before storing the tractor for the winter, drain the fuel tank, add fuel stabilizer, and run the engine for a few minutes to circulate the stabilized fuel. Disconnect the battery and store it in a cool, dry place.

Frequently Asked Questions
What engine is in the Massey Ferguson 253?
The Massey Ferguson 253 typically uses a Perkins AD3.152 three-cylinder diesel engine, producing around 47 horsepower.
What is the PTO horsepower on a 253?
The PTO horsepower on a Massey Ferguson 253 is approximately 40 horsepower at 540 RPM.
What oil filter fits the 253?
A common oil filter for the Massey Ferguson 253 is a Fram PH2870A, or a NAPA 1773. Always verify compatibility with your specific engine serial number.
What are common parts needed for the 253?
Common parts needed for the Massey Ferguson 253 include fuel filters, oil filters, air filters, hydraulic filters, fan belts, radiator hoses, hydraulic seals, steering components like tie rod ends, and clutch components such as clutch discs and pressure plates.
